What is Ichor Holdings's EPS (diluted)?
Ichor Holdings (ICHR) reported EPS (diluted) of -$0.07 in Q1 2026.
How has Ichor Holdings's EPS (diluted) changed year-over-year?
Ichor Holdings's EPS (diluted) increased by 46.2% year-over-year, from -$0.13 to -$0.07.

What does EPS (diluted) mean?
Net income divided by the weighted-average number of shares outstanding plus all potentially dilutive securities (stock options, convertibles, warrants). The most conservative EPS measure.
